Why is dhamrai famous?

Dhamrai Roth Jatra And Fair: The annual Jagannath Roth Jatra is a famous Hindu festival attracting thousands of people. Dhamrai is well known for this annual festival all throughout Bangladesh. Roth jatra festival begins on around the 10 days of Bangla Calendar month of Ashar and “Ulto Roth” takes place one week after.

Is upazila and thana same?

Upazilas were formerly known as thana, which literally means police station. Despite the meaning, thanas functioned much as an administrative and geographic region, much as today’s upazilas. In 1982 thanas were re-termed to as upazilas with provisions for semi-autonomous local governance.

How many upazila are there?

495 upazilas
Bangladesh has 495 upazilas (as of 31 August 2021). The upazilas are the second lowest tier of regional administration in Bangladesh.

Which division is biggest in Bangladesh?

Chittagong Division
Chittagong Division, officially known as Chattogram Division, is geographically the largest of the eight administrative divisions of Bangladesh. It covers the south-easternmost areas of the country, with a total area of 33,909.00 km2 (13,092.34 sq mi) and a population at the 2011 census of 28,423,019.

How many villages are there in Savar?

380 villages
Savar Upazila is divided into Savar Municipality and 13 union parishads: Aminbazar, Ashulia, Banogram, Bhakurta, Birulia, Dhamsona, Kaundia, Pathalia, Savar, Shimulia, Tetuljhora, and Yearpur. The union parishads are subdivided into 220 mauzas and 380 villages.

Where is Dhamrai Upazila?

Dhamrai Upazila is located about 40 kilometers northwest of the capital city of Dhaka. It is one of the six Upazilas of the Dhaka district. The Upazila is surrounded by the Upazilas of Mirzapur and Kaliakair and Nagarpur on the north, Singair on the south, Savar in the east, and Saturia on the west.

What is the history of Dhamrai in Dhaka?

Dhamrai was once under the Thana (now Upazila) of Savar. Dhamrai became a Thana itself in 1914 during the British rule; the same year Dhamrai Hardinge High School was established. In 1947 it was put under the district of Dhaka. On December 15, 1984, Dhamrai was upgraded into a full-fledged Upazila.

How many mauzas are there in Dhamrai Upazila?

Dhamrai Upazila is divided into Dhamrai Municipality and 16 union parishads: Amta, Baisakanda, Balia, Bhararia, Chauhat, Dhamrai, Gangutia, Jadabpur, Kulla, Kushura, Nannar, Rowail, Sanora, Sombhog, Suapur, and Sutipara. The union parishads are subdivided into 306 mauzas and 396 villages.
